Panasonic HD & 4K Camcorder Models Lineup & Comparison – This is a roundup of available Panasonic camcorder models for 2021-2022. Panasonic has trimmed the number of models available this year from last year. Panasonic has introduced several 4K Ultra HD camcorders, including the Panasonic HC-1500 Compact Pro model. 4K camcorders have 4x higher resolution than full HD (same as your movie theater 4K projector).
All Panasonic models listed here have built-in WiFi. The The latest Pro models HC-X1500 and HC-X2000 can shoot 4K Video at up to 60 frames/second , have dual SD Card Slots, and have a fast f1.8 lens for better low light performance. Camcorder Glossary of Terms |
4K Ultra HD Camcorder = 4K or Ultra HD is the new standard for TVs and for camcorders. 4K has 4x the resolution of Full HD. This is about the same resolution and sharpness as the 4K projectors at your local movie theater. Each frame of video is 8 megapixels versus 2 megapixels for full HD. Shooting in 4K today, will future proof your videos, as most TVs in the near future will be 4K TVs. Even if you shoot in 4K and convert it to Full HD, the picture will be far sharper than if it had been shot in HD. We expect new models to be introduced at CES 2018. Optical Zoom = This is the maximum zoom using the lens of the camcorder. A 10x zoom brings the action in about 10 times closer at its maximum. Flash Memory = This refers to the way the camcorder records video. Flash memory camcorders normally record to memory cards (SDHC). There are some that have no card, and just have a fixed amount of internal memory such as the Flip Camcorders. Dual Flash = This type of camcorder has both internal memory and can also record to memory cards. Windproof Mic = The newest Panasonic HC-WXF991K and the Panasonic HC-V770 both have a Windproof Microphone, made to reduce wind noise substantially when using your camcorder outdoors. Twin Camera = The Panasonic HC-WXF991K has a separate camera built into the end of the lcd, that can take a picture-in-a-picture. You can use this to take a wide angle shot of a soccer game, and with the main camera take a closeup of a player kicking the ball. Or a separate shot of yourself, or the crowd, as the action takes place on the field. The newest model now records the video from the second camera separately. Multi Manual Dial = On the Panasonic HC-WXF991K and the Panasonic HC-V770 models, a Small Manual Dial on the front of the camcorder can adjust Focus, White Balance Mode, Shutter Speed, Iris, Sharpness, Color Saturation, White Balance Fine, or Brightness. Imager Size = This refers to the Imager of the camcorder, where the light hits from the lens. This is like the retina of the eye. The larger the imager, the better the quality of the video and better low light performance. High end camcorders generally have a larger imager. Larger is better. A 1/3-inch imager is larger than a 1/4.5-inch imager. ![]() ![]() Low Light Lenses = Larger and faster lenses allow more light in for greater low light sensitivity. Lenses with low f stop specifications are considered fast lenses. The camcorders on this page all have fast low light lenses with an f stop of f1.8 or lower (lower is better). The Panasonic HC-X920 has a new f1.5 lens, which is the most light sensitive of any consumer camcorder lens. |
